Are there Mercedes-Benz specialist repair shops directly on Fishers Island, and if not, what is the best option?

There are no dedicated Mercedes-Benz dealerships or independent specialists physically located on Fishers Island. The most common and recommended solution is to utilize a mainland-based Mercedes specialist or dealership, coordinating vehicle transport via the Fishers Island Ferry to a trusted shop in New London, CT, or southeastern Connecticut, which is the primary access point.

How does the coastal Fishers Island climate affect my Mercedes-Benz, and what specific services should I prioritize?

The salty, humid marine air accelerates corrosion, particularly on brake components, undercarriage, and electronic connections. Prioritize regular undercarriage washes and inspections, and be vigilant for warning lights related to sensors or electrical systems that may be impacted by corrosion or moisture.

What are the typical costs for common Mercedes-Benz repairs in this area, considering the ferry logistics?

Labor rates align with mainland CT specialists, typically $180-$250/hour, but you must factor in the significant cost and time for ferry transport for both the initial drop-off and pickup. This often makes it more cost-effective to bundle multiple services or repairs into a single trip to the mainland shop.

What is the most important factor when choosing a mainland shop for my Mercedes from Fishers Island?

The most critical factor is finding a shop that understands and can accommodate the ferry schedule and your island logistics. Look for a reputable Mercedes specialist in New London or Groton, CT, who offers loaner cars, can work with transport services, and has efficient communication to minimize your required trips.

For routine maintenance (like an A or B Service), should I try to get service on the island or always go to the mainland?

Always plan to go to a certified mainland specialist. While a local Fishers Island general mechanic might handle basic tasks, Mercedes-Benz's complex systems require specialized diagnostics, proprietary tools, and OEM parts to maintain performance and warranty, which are only available at dedicated shops.
